Output 73c89423aa9b197c1e3a5590e4e48e2c00352b31dfe228c579d7ea13241d6275:0

value
1954059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01aab59f55acb2a2d4ef17b3c7fcc053b5da73d9 OP_EQUAL
address
31qq6qVr8GSzAJhKgCaSU5H4m4fZdq2Ur4
transaction
73c89423aa9b197c1e3a5590e4e48e2c00352b31dfe228c579d7ea13241d6275
spent
true